We are committed to advancing the field of electrochemical energy conversion through the rational design of high-performance electrocatalysts. Our work spans a broad range of topics, including water splitting, methane electrooxidation, and metal-air batteries. We specialize in developing 'Low-Pt' and 'No-Pt' catalyst systems, self-supported and binder-free electrodes, and high-rate oxygen evolution electrodes operating at industrial current densities. Recent efforts have focused on engineering multimetallic and high-entropy oxide/hydroxide systems that combine abundant transition metals with trace amounts of noble elements, achieving exceptional activity and stability in acidic and alkaline electrolytes. Our approach integrates nanoscale structural tuning, electrochemical dealloying, and surface electronic structure optimization to push the limits of electrocatalytic performance for real-world applications.
